Join Rebecca Schools, a network of private therapeutic day schools serving children ages 3 to 21 with neurodevelopmental delays, including autism spectrum disorders. Founded in 2006, we use the DIRFloortime® model to foster communication, social interaction, and personal growth. Our skilled educators and therapists collaborate in thoughtfully designed sensory gyms, art studios, and bright classrooms, creating a nurturing environment where students thrive.

Your Role as a School Nurse

  • Administer Health Services & Medication – Provide health services, including medication administration and management, ensuring students’ medical needs are met throughout the school day. Advocate for the health rights of all students.
  • Track & Maintain Student Health Records – Collect, organize, and maintain annual medical forms for students and staff while ensuring confidentiality. Complete required reports for city and state agencies and document medical incidents.
  • Support Student Well-Being & Hygiene – Assist students in developing self-care skills related to personal hygiene, illness prevention, and managing medical conditions to promote independence and confidence in daily activities.
  • Respond to Medical Emergencies & Ensure Safety – Be available for medical emergencies, administer first aid, and provide care for staff and student incidents. Maintain necessary medical equipment and supplies while following Department of Health guidelines.
  • Collaborate with Staff & Educate the Community – Work closely with teachers, families, and staff to provide consistent medical support. Conduct in-services on relevant health topics and maintain professional competence through staff development and continuing education programs.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Nursing (BSN) required.
  • Must hold a valid New York State (NYS) nursing license and state certification.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ills to effectively collaborate with students, staff, and parents.
  • Proven ability to establish and maintain positive, professional relationships with students, staff, and parents, fostering a supportive learning environment.
